 Obiettivo del progetto (Objective)

'The conference EuroNanoForum 2009 will be established as a foremost European congress in Nanotechnology within the framework of the Czech presidency. The conference will address the impact of nanotechnologies on sustainable economy focusing on their applications in resource- and eco-efficient industrial production, environmental protection and remediation, and energy production and conservation in the coming years. It aims to: (i) present the nanotechnology state of the art in the realm of sustainable economy;(ii) facilitate intensive exchange of views, information and experience between researches and representatives of industry, investors as well as policy makers and representatives of civil society; (iii) foster networking and knowledge transfer between different national and European stakeholders; and (iv) promote responsible governance in nanotechnology.'
